Back

Beschleunigen Sie Ihr Coding mit diesen Tastaturkürzeln

Beschleunigen Sie Ihr Coding mit diesen Tastaturkürzeln

Jedes Mal, wenn Sie zur Maus greifen, um eine Datei zu öffnen, durch Menüs zu klicken oder eine Suche zu starten, wird Ihr Fokus unterbrochen. Diese kleinen Unterbrechungen summieren sich. Die gute Nachricht: Eine Handvoll gut ausgewählter Tastaturkürzel für Entwickler kann die meisten davon eliminieren, ohne dass Sie hundert Tastenkombinationen auswendig lernen müssen.

Dieser Artikel konzentriert sich auf wirkungsvolle Shortcuts, gruppiert nach Workflow – mit Schwerpunkt auf VS Code und Browser-DevTools. Alle Shortcuts sind als Windows/Linux | macOS aufgeführt. Beachten Sie, dass Tastenkürzel je nach Editor-Version, Betriebssystem und Benutzerkonfiguration variieren können. Überprüfen Sie daher Ihre eigene Konfiguration, falls etwas nicht wie erwartet funktioniert.

Wichtigste Erkenntnisse

  • Eine kleine Auswahl gezielter Tastaturkürzel kann die Mausabhängigkeit deutlich reduzieren und Sie im Flow halten.
  • Navigation, Bearbeitung, Suche und Debugging haben jeweils einige wirkungsvolle Shortcuts, die es sich lohnt, zuerst zu lernen.
  • Multi-Cursor-Bearbeitung und Symbol-Umbenennung (F2) gehören zu den zeitsparendsten Features in VS Code.
  • Shortcuts können sich zwischen Editoren, Betriebssystemversionen und benutzerdefinierten Keybindings unterscheiden – überprüfen Sie immer Ihre eigene Konfiguration.

Diese VS Code-Shortcuts bewältigen die häufigsten Navigationsaufgaben:

AktionWindows/LinuxmacOS
Datei schnell nach Namen öffnenCtrl+PCmd+P
Zur Definition springenF12F12
Zurück zur vorherigen PositionAlt+←Ctrl+-
Zu Symbol in Datei springenCtrl+Shift+OCmd+Shift+O
Befehlspalette öffnenCtrl+Shift+PCmd+Shift+P

Ctrl+P / Cmd+P allein ersetzt das meiste Browsen in der Seitenleiste. Geben Sie einen Teil des Dateinamens ein und öffnen Sie sie sofort. Kombinieren Sie es mit F12, um zu einer Definition zu springen, dann Alt+← / Ctrl+-, um zurückzukehren – keine Maus erforderlich.

Bearbeitung: Code schneller schreiben und umformen

Diese Shortcuts für Coding-Produktivität bewältigen die repetitive Textmanipulation, die Sie ausbremst:

  • Zeilenkommentar umschalten: Ctrl+/ / Cmd+/ — funktioniert auf der aktuellen Zeile oder einer Auswahl.
  • Zeile nach oben/unten verschieben: Alt+↑ / Option+↑ und Alt+↓ / Option+↓ — Logik neu anordnen ohne Ausschneiden und Einfügen.
  • Zeile duplizieren: Shift+Alt+↓ / Shift+Option+↓ — kopiert die aktuelle Zeile direkt darunter.
  • Zeile löschen: Ctrl+Shift+K / Cmd+Shift+K.
  • Multi-Cursor: Alt+Klick / Option+Klick — platzieren Sie zusätzliche Cursor und tippen Sie dann, um alle Positionen gleichzeitig zu bearbeiten.

Multi-Cursor-Bearbeitung ist besonders nützlich beim Umbenennen wiederholter Variablen oder beim gleichzeitigen Hinzufügen desselben Texts zu mehreren Zeilen.

Suche und Refactoring: Code über Dateien hinweg ändern

AktionWindows/LinuxmacOS
Innerhalb der Datei suchenCtrl+FCmd+F
Im gesamten Projekt suchenCtrl+Shift+FCmd+Shift+F
In Datei ersetzenCtrl+HOption+Cmd+F
Symbol umbenennen (alle Referenzen)F2F2
Alle Vorkommen eines Wortes auswählenCtrl+Shift+LCmd+Shift+L

F2 ist die sauberste Methode, um eine Variable oder Funktion umzubenennen. Es aktualisiert automatisch jede Referenz im Gültigkeitsbereich – sicherer und schneller als ein manuelles Suchen-und-Ersetzen.

Debugging: DevTools-Tastaturkürzel, die wichtig sind

Ob Sie in VS Code oder Browser-DevTools debuggen, diese Shortcuts decken den Kern-Workflow ab:

  • Breakpoint umschalten: F9 (VS Code).
  • Starten / Fortsetzen: F5.
  • Überspringen: F10.
  • Hineinspringen: F11.
  • Herausspringen: Shift+F11.

In den Chrome DevTools öffnen Sie das Panel mit F12 oder Ctrl+Shift+I / Cmd+Option+I. Einmal drin, öffnet Ctrl+P / Cmd+P eine Dateiauswahl – dasselbe Muskelgedächtnis wie in VS Code. Die vollständige Liste können Sie in der DevTools-Shortcuts-Dokumentation erkunden.

Ein Hinweis zu Shortcuts, die nicht immer übertragbar sind

Mehrere in populären Leitfäden aufgeführte Shortcuts sind editorspezifisch oder kollidieren mit Tastenbelegungen auf Betriebssystemebene. Zum Beispiel wählt Ctrl+D in VS Code das nächste Vorkommen des markierten Wortes aus – es dupliziert nicht die Zeile, was ein häufiges Missverständnis ist, das von anderen Editoren übernommen wurde. Überprüfen Sie immer Ihre Keybindings über Einstellungen → Tastaturkürzel (Ctrl+K Ctrl+S / Cmd+K Cmd+S) oder die offizielle VS Code Keybindings-Referenz, bevor Sie Standardeinstellungen voraussetzen.

Fazit

Wählen Sie fünf Shortcuts aus dieser Liste aus, die zu Ihren am häufigsten wiederholten Aktionen passen. Verwenden Sie sie eine Woche lang ausschließlich. Sobald sie sich automatisch anfühlen, fügen Sie fünf weitere hinzu. Die Optimierung Ihres Entwickler-Workflows durch Shortcuts bedeutet nicht, alles auswendig zu lernen – es geht darum, die spezifischen Reibungspunkte zu beseitigen, die Ihr Denken am häufigsten unterbrechen.

FAQs

Drücken Sie Ctrl+P unter Windows/Linux oder Cmd+P unter macOS, um den Quick-Open-Dialog zu öffnen. Beginnen Sie, einen beliebigen Teil des Dateinamens einzugeben, und wählen Sie ihn aus den Ergebnissen aus. Dies ist schneller als die Navigation in der Seitenleiste und funktioniert auch in großen Projekten mit vielen Dateien gut.

Halten Sie Alt unter Windows/Linux oder Option unter macOS gedrückt und klicken Sie an jede Position, an der Sie einen Cursor platzieren möchten. Sie können dann an allen Cursor-Positionen gleichzeitig tippen, löschen oder einfügen. Dies ist besonders nützlich für die Bearbeitung wiederholter Muster wie Variablennamen oder ähnlicher Codezeilen.

F2 löst eine Symbol-Umbenennung aus. Im Gegensatz zu einem textbasierten Suchen-und-Ersetzen versteht es den Code-Kontext und benennt nur die tatsächlichen Referenzen zu diesem Symbol innerhalb seines Gültigkeitsbereichs um. Dies vermeidet versehentliche Änderungen an nicht verwandtem Text, der zufällig dieselbe Zeichenfolge enthält.

Nicht immer. Shortcuts können sich zwischen Editoren erheblich unterscheiden. Zum Beispiel wählt Ctrl+D in VS Code das nächste Vorkommen aus, kann aber in anderen Editoren eine Zeile duplizieren. Überprüfen Sie immer die Keybinding-Einstellungen Ihres Editors, um zu bestätigen, was jeder Shortcut bewirkt, bevor Sie sich darauf verlassen.

Understand every bug

Uncover frustrations, understand bugs and fix slowdowns like never before with OpenReplay — the open-source session replay tool for developers. Self-host it in minutes, and have complete control over your customer data. Check our GitHub repo and join the thousands of developers in our community.

OpenReplay